What Is a Fractured Spine?

Your spine consists of. These vertebrae stack upon each other to create a protective column for your spinal cord—the vital bundle of nerves that transmits signals between your brain and the rest of your body.

A fractured spine occurs when one or more of these vertebrae break or crack. The severity depends on which vertebrae are affected, how badly they’re damaged, whether the fracture is stable or unstable, and most critically, whether the injury has affected your spinal cord or nerve roots.

Many people use “broken back” to describe various spinal injuries, but this term specifically refers to fractures of the vertebrae themselves. It’s important to understand that broken vertebrae in back can range from hairline cracks that heal on their own to severe breaks that compromise spinal stability and require immediate surgical intervention.

The location of your fracture matters significantly. Cervical spine fractures in your neck carry the highest risk of neurological complications. Thoracic and lumbar fractures in your mid and lower back are more common but may have different treatment implications depending on their specific characteristics.

Types of Spinal Fractures

Understanding the different types of spinal fractures helps you and your physician determine the most appropriate treatment approach. Spine specialists classify fractures based on how the bone breaks and whether the fracture threatens spinal stability.

Compression Fractures

often Compression fractures occur when the front portion of a vertebra collapses, creating a wedge-shaped deformity. These are the most common type of spinal fracture, particularly in patients with osteoporosis. The vertebra’s front section compresses while the back portion remains intact.

may Many compression fractures are stable and heal with conservative treatment including bracing and activity modification. Patients often recover successfully without surgery when these fractures are properly diagnosed and managed.

Burst Fractures

Burst fractures happen when your vertebra breaks in multiple directions, often from severe trauma like a fall from height or motor vehicle accident. Unlike compression fractures that affect only the front of the vertebra, burst fractures involve the entire bone structure.

These fractures can push bone fragments into your spinal canal, potentially damaging your spinal cord. Burst fractures often require surgical stabilization to protect your neurological function.

Flexion-Distraction Fractures

Also called “Chance fractures,” these injuries result from sudden forward flexion combined with distraction forces that pull the spine apart. They commonly occur in high-speed car accidents when wearing only a lap belt.

The vertebra literally pulls apart, with the fracture line running horizontally through the bone. These fractures are inherently unstable and typically require surgical treatment.

Fracture-Dislocations

The most severe category, often fracture-dislocations involve both a broken vertebra and displacement of the vertebrae relative to each other. These high-energy injuries almost always damage the spinal cord and require immediate surgical intervention to realign the spine and decompress neural structures.

Recovery from fracture-dislocations often involves extensive rehabilitation. Early surgical intervention and comprehensive therapy provide the best opportunity for neurological recovery.

Symptoms of a Broken Back

Recognizing the signs of a spinal fracture is critical for seeking timely medical care. Symptoms vary considerably based on fracture type, location, and whether your spinal cord or nerve roots have been affected.

Common symptoms include:

  • Severe back or neck pain that starts immediately after an injury or develops gradually with osteoporotic fractures
  • Pain that worsens with movement, particularly bending, twisting, or bearing weight
  • Limited mobility and difficulty standing upright or walking
  • Muscle spasms in your back as your body attempts to stabilize the injured area
  • Tenderness when touching the injured area of your spine

Neurological symptoms requiring urgent evaluation:

  • Numbness or tingling in your arms or legs
  • Weakness in your extremities
  • Loss of bowel or bladder control
  • Difficulty walking or maintaining balance
  • Paralysis in severe cases with spinal cord involvement

Some fractures, particularly compression fractures from osteoporosis, may initially cause only mild to moderate pain that you might dismiss as typical back pain. However, even subtle symptoms following trauma deserve professional evaluation.

The presence of any neurological symptoms constitutes a medical emergency requiring immediate care. Don’t wait—seek evaluation right away if you experience these warning signs.

Common Causes of Spinal Fractures

Spinal fractures result from various mechanisms. Understanding how these injuries occur helps both in prevention and in determining appropriate treatment approaches.

High-Energy Trauma: Motor vehicle accidents account for. The high speeds and sudden deceleration forces involved in car crashes can cause severe spinal injuries.

Sports and Recreation: High-impact sports including football, gymnastics, diving, and horseback riding carry inherent spinal fracture risks. Even recreational activities like skiing or mountain biking can result in fractures when falls occur at high speeds or awkward angles.

Osteoporosis and Bone Disease: As bones weaken with age or disease, they become susceptible to fractures from minimal trauma. Osteoporotic compression fractures can occur during routine activities like lifting groceries, bending forward, or even coughing. These low-energy fractures are particularly common in postmenopausal women and older adults.

Pathological Fractures: Cancer that spreads to the spine or primary bone tumors can weaken vertebrae, making them vulnerable to fracture even without significant trauma. These pathological fractures require specialized treatment addressing both the fracture and underlying disease.

Can You Walk with a Broken Back?

This question naturally arises for patients diagnosed with spinal fractures or those concerned about potential injuries. The answer depends entirely on the fracture’s location, severity, stability, and whether spinal cord or nerve damage has occurred.

Stable Fractures:Many people with stable compression fractures continue walking, though often with pain and restricted mobility. A back brace helps stabilize your spine during healing, allowing controlled movement while protecting the injured vertebra.

Unstable Fractures: Fractures that compromise spinal stability or threaten your spinal cord typically require strict activity restrictions or immediate surgical stabilization. Attempting to walk with an unstable fracture risks further displacement and potential spinal cord injury.

Fractures with Neurological Involvement: When a fracture damages your spinal cord or nerve roots, walking ability depends on the severity and level of neurological injury. Complete spinal cord injuries may result in paralysis, while incomplete injuries often allow for functional recovery through rehabilitation.

Walking ability after a spinal fracture varies tremendously between patients. Only a comprehensive evaluation by a spine specialist can determine whether walking is safe and what restrictions apply during your recovery.

Never assume that walking ability means the injury isn’t serious. Some dangerous fractures allow limited mobility initially before worsening without proper treatment.

Diagnosis and Evaluation

Accurate diagnosis forms the foundation of effective treatment. When you consult a spine specialist about a suspected spinal fracture, expect a thorough evaluation process.

Your physical examination includes assessment of tenderness along your spine, evaluation of your posture and gait, and comprehensive neurological testing to check muscle strength, reflexes, and sensation. Your physician will also review your medical history, including how the injury occurred and what symptoms you’ve experienced.

Imaging studies provide critical information about fracture characteristics. X-rays typically serve as the initial diagnostic tool, revealing bone alignment and obvious fractures.

CT scans offer detailed views of bone structure, helping identify fracture patterns and fragment positions. making it essential when neurological symptoms are present.

This comprehensive evaluation allows your spine specialist to classify the fracture type, assess stability, identify any spinal cord or nerve involvement, and develop an appropriate treatment plan tailored to your specific injury.

Treatment Options for Broken Backs

Treatment for spinal fractures ranges from conservative management to advanced surgical techniques. The approach depends on fracture stability, location, severity, neurological status, and your overall health.

Conservative Treatment

Many stable fractures heal successfully without surgery. Conservative treatment typically includes pain management with medications, bracing to immobilize your spine and prevent further injury, activity modification to avoid movements that stress the healing vertebra, and physical therapy to maintain muscle strength and flexibility.

For osteoporotic compression fractures, vertebroplasty or kyphoplasty—minimally invasive procedures that inject bone cement into the fractured vertebra—can provide rapid pain relief while stabilizing the bone. These procedures often allow patients to return to normal activities much faster than traditional conservative management alone.

Surgical Treatment

Unstable fractures, those causing spinal cord compression, or injuries failing conservative treatment may require surgery. Modern spine surgery emphasizes minimally invasive techniques that reduce tissue damage, decrease recovery time, and minimize surgical risks.

Surgical options include spinal fusion to permanently join affected vertebrae using bone grafts and hardware, decompression procedures to remove bone fragments or tissue pressing on your spinal cord or nerves, and instrumentation with screws, rods, and plates to stabilize your spine during healing.

Recovery and Rehabilitation

Recovery from a spinal fracture varies significantly depending on injury severity and treatment approach. Setting realistic expectations helps you stay motivated throughout the healing process.

Vertebral compression fractures typically require 8-12 weeks of immobilization and structured physical therapy for adequate bone healing and functional recovery. During this time, bone gradually remodels and strengthens. However, more severe fractures or those requiring surgery may involve longer recovery periods.

Physical therapy plays a central role in recovery. A skilled physical therapist designs exercises to restore strength, improve flexibility, enhance balance, and gradually increase functional capacity.

Early therapy focuses on gentle range-of-motion exercises, progressing to strengthening and functional activities as healing permits. Your therapist will adjust your program based on your progress and tolerance.

Your spine specialist will provide specific guidelines about when you can return to work, driving, and recreational activities. Following these recommendations carefully prevents re-injury and promotes optimal healing.

Most patients with stable fractures managed conservatively return to normal activities within three to four months, though complete bone remodeling continues for up to a year. Patience and commitment to your rehabilitation program are essential for the best outcome.

When to Seek Expert Spine Care

Knowing when to seek professional evaluation can make a critical difference in your outcome. Any significant back trauma—whether from a car accident, fall, or sports injury—warrants prompt medical assessment even if symptoms seem manageable initially.

Seek immediate emergency care if you experience severe back or neck pain following trauma, numbness or weakness in your arms or legs, loss of bowel or bladder control, or inability to stand or walk after an injury. These symptoms suggest potential spinal cord involvement requiring urgent intervention.

For less acute situations, schedule an evaluation with a board-certified spine specialist if you have persistent back pain following an injury, gradually worsening pain over weeks or months, pain that interferes with daily activities or sleep, or back pain accompanied by unexplained weight loss or fever.
